Crocodile Census Begins In Bhitarkanika National Park

Bhubaneswar: The forest department has commenced the annual crocodile headcount exercise in the Bhitarkanika National Park in Kendrapara district today. The exercise will continue till January 22. AM/NS India conducts Mock Drill to enhance onsite emergency preparedness

Paradeep, January 18, 2025: ArcelorMittal Nippon Steel India (AM/NS India) has conducted a full-scale mock drill to test its onsite emergency preparedness capabilities. As per the schedule of the District Crisis Group (DCG), Jagatsinghpur, the mock drill was conducted in the presence of government authorities, delegates from neighbouring industries, and emergency services.
